Practical Information for Campers

Camping Tips: The best times to visit Granite Lake are late spring through early fall. Campers are advised to bring appropriate gear for variable weather and to be mindful of wildlife.

Local Amenities: The area boasts several well-equipped campsites, a visitor centre, and nearby stores for camping supplies.

Regulations and Camping Practices: Permits are required for camping, and visitors are encouraged to follow leave-no-trace principles to preserve the lake’s natural beauty.

FAQs on Granite Lake Camping

1. What are the best times to visit Granite Lake for camping?

Answer: The prime time for camping at Granite Lake is from late spring to early fall, offering the most pleasant weather conditions for outdoor activities.

2. Are there any specific camping regulations at Granite Lake?

Answer: Yes, campers must adhere to specific regulations, including obtaining camping permits, following leave-no-trace principles, and respecting wildlife and natural habitats.

3. What activities can I enjoy while camping at Granite Lake?

Answer: Granite Lake offers a variety of activities like hiking, fishing, boating, wildlife observation, and stargazing, appealing to a wide range of interests.

4. Is Granite Lake suitable for family camping?

Answer: Absolutely; Granite Lake is family-friendly, offering various recreational activities suitable for all ages and a safe, welcoming environment for family trips.

5. Are there any historical sites near Granite Lake?

Answer: Yes, the area around Granite Lake is rich in historical sites, including ancient ruins and cultural landmarks, each with its unique story and significance.

6. What types of camping accommodations are available at Granite Lake?

Answer: Granite Lake caters to different camping preferences, offering designated campgrounds with basic amenities, backcountry camping for a more rugged experience, and RV sites for those who prefer it.

7. How can I ensure an environmentally responsible camping experience at Granite Lake?

Answer: Campers are encouraged to practice leave-no-trace principles, properly dispose of waste, minimize campfire impacts, and respect wildlife and natural resources to maintain the ecological balance of Granite Lake.

8. Is there a visitor centre at Granite Lake, and what resources are available there?

Answer: Yes, Granite Lake has a visitor centre offering resources like maps, educational exhibits about the local ecosystem and history, and information on trails and camping regulations.

9. Can I fish at Granite Lake, and what species might I find?

Answer: Fishing is a popular activity at Granite Lake, with species like trout and bass commonly found. Make sure to check for any specific fishing regulations or necessary permits.

10. What wildlife might I encounter while camping at Granite Lake?

Answer: The area around Granite Lake is home to diverse wildlife, including deer, birds, small mammals, and occasionally, bear sightings, offering enriching wildlife observation opportunities.
